Orban called on Europe to begin negotiations with Moscow and reduce support for Kyiv.

By Maxim Svetlyshev

Hungarian Prime Minister Viktor Orbán believes Europe should engage in direct negotiations with Russia, including on issues related to the settlement of the armed conflict in Ukraine. Orbán emphasizes that by refusing to negotiate with Russia, Europe is making a grave mistake. He argues that the latest, 19th round of sanctions clearly demonstrates that the previous ones have failed.

According to Orbán, to ensure peace and stability in Europe, Ukraine must under no circumstances become a member of the European Union, remaining a strategic partner. Furthermore, the Hungarian prime minister calls for minimizing funding for Ukraine, focusing on preserving resources in Europe. Orbán states that as long as European funds flow freely to the Kyiv regime, there will be no economic growth in Europe itself…
